Phylum Pseudomonadota (Proteobacteria), Class Gammaproteobacteria, Order Pasteurellales, Family Pasteurellaceae, Genus
Necropsobacter, Necropsobacter rosorum Christensen et al. 2011, type species of the genus.
Gram-negative coccoid or pleomorphic rods. Non-motile.
Colonies on bovine blood agar are regular, circular and slightly raised with an entire
margin, smooth, shiny, opaque with a greyish tinge and 2.0 mm in diameter after 24 h
of incubation at 37 ºC. Haemolysis is not observed on bovine blood agar. Grows on
MacConkey agar. No growth in the presence of KCN.
Isolated from lesions in laboratory rodents, rabbits and humans.

Positive results for catalase, alpha-glucosidase, alpha- and beta-galactosidase,
methyl red test, nitrate reduction, oxidase, porphyrin test, phosphatase, beta-xylosidase, acid production from: L(+) arabinose, D(+)
arabitol, dextrin, dulcitol, D(-) fructose, L(-) fucose, D(+) glucose (without gas production), D(+) galactose, glycerol (delayed), lactose
(delayed), D(+) mannose, maltose, melibiose, raffinose, L(+) rhamnose, D(-) ribose, sucrose, trehalose, and D(+)xylose.
Negative results for arginine dehydrolase, citrate (Simmons), alpha-fucosidase, beta-glucosidase, beta-glucuronidase, gelatinase,
H2S production (TSI), indole production, lysine decarboxylase, alpha-mannosidase, ornithine decarboxylase, phenylalanine
deaminase, Tweens 20 and 80 hydrolysis, urease, Voges-Proskauer test, acid production from: adonitol, amygdalin, arbutin,
cellobiose, aesculin, meso-erythritol, D(+) fucose, gentiobiose, D(+) glycogen, myo-inositol, inulin, D(-) mannitol, melezitose, salicin,
D(-) sorbitol, L(-) sorbose, turanose, xylitol and L(-) xylose.
